What happens when people interact with the environment?
Vladimir [108]

Answer:

Human Impacts on the Environment. Humans impact the physical environment in many ways: overpopulation, pollution, burning fossil fuels, and deforestation. Changes like these have triggered climate change, soil erosion, poor air quality, and undrinkable water.

What is a difference between rocks and minerals
lesya692 [45]

Explanation:

minerals- is a naturally occuring inorganic solid with a chemical composition and crystalline structure.

rocks- is aggregate of more minerals some rocks are predominantly composed minerals.
